Macareus (son of Helios)
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
In Greek mythology, Macareus (Ancient Greek: Μακαρεύς, romanized: Makareus, lit. 'happy', 'blissful', or 'blessed'[1]) or Macar (/ˈmeɪkər/; Μάκαρ Makar) was one of the Heliadae, sons of Helios and Rhodos.
